Kübler Group 2 Allgemeine Hinweise 2 Allgemeine Hinweise Lesen Sie dieses Dokument sorgfältig, bevor Sie mit dem Produkt arbeiten, es montieren oder in Betrieb nehmen. 2.1 Zielgruppe Das Gerät darf nur von Personen projektiert, installiert, in Betrieb genommen und instandgehal- ten werden, die folgende Befähigungen und Bedingungen erfüllen: •...
Seite 6
2 Allgemeine Hinweise Kübler Group HINWEIS Klassifizierung: Ergänzende Informationen zur Bedienung des Produktes sowie Tipps und Empfehlungen für einen effizienten und störungsfreien Betrieb. 6 - DE HB Profinet-Schnittstelle - R67069.0001 - 01...
Kübler Group 3 Produktbeschreibung 3 Produktbeschreibung 3.1 Technische Daten Sendix 58xx Singleturn Technologie Optisch Multiturn Technologie Optisch, mechanisches Getriebe Auflösung Singleturn (MUR) Max. 16 bit (Default 13 bit) Auflösung Multiturn (NDR) Max. 12 bit Auflösung Multiturn (TMR) Max. 28 bit (Default 25 bit) Genauigkeit ±...
Seite 8
3 Produktbeschreibung Kübler Group Elektrische Kennwerte für die Drehgeber Sendix 58xx Versorgungsspannung 10 … 30 V DC Stomaufnahme (ohne Last) 10 … 30 V DC max. 110 mA Verpolschutz der Versorgungsspannung Ausgang PROFINET Ethernet 100Base-TX nach IEEE 802.x Anschlussart 3 x M12 Stecker Schnittstelle PROFINET IO Implementierte Profilversionen Encoder Profile Version 4.1...
3 Produktbeschreibung Kübler Group 3.3 Schnittstellenbeschreibung PROFINET IO PROFINET ist ein Mechanismus zum Datenaustausch zwischen Steuerungen und Geräten. Controller können SPS, DCS oder PACs (Programmable Logic Controllers, Distributed Control Systems, oder Programmable Automation Controllers.) sein. Geräte können jegliche I/O-Blöcke, Visionssysteme, Messsensoren, RFID-Lesegeräte, Antriebe, Prozessinstrumente, Proxies oder sogar andere Steuerungen sein.
Kübler Group 3 Produktbeschreibung 108020747 Parametrierung Zur Parametrierung sind die GSD-Dateien (General Station Description) der zu konfigurieren- den Feldgeräte erforderlich. Das XML-basierte GSDML beschreibt die Eigenschaften und Funk- tionen der PROFINET IO-Feldgeräte. Es enthält alle für das Engineering sowie für den Daten- austausch mit dem Feldgerät relevanten Daten.
Kübler Group 3 Produktbeschreibung • RTA • LLDP • SNMP • MIB-II • LLDP-MIB • PTCP • MRP • FSU • Conformance Class C • Application Class 6 • Encoder Class 4 • NetloadClass III • IM0 lesbar • Min. DeviceInterval = 1000 µs •...
Seite 14
3 Produktbeschreibung Kübler Group Optionale PRO- Beschreibung Sendix 58x8 (En- Sendix F58x8 (En- FINET Features coder Profil 4.1) coder-Profil 4.2) Network Redun- Media Redundancy Protocol Implementiert Implementiert dancy with Media bietet Netzwerkringredundanz Redundancy Pro- für PROFINET IO Echtzeitnetz- tocol (MRP) werke System Redun- Ermöglicht einen Primär- und...
Seite 15
Kübler Group 3 Produktbeschreibung Optionale PRO- Beschreibung Sendix 58x8 (En- Sendix F58x8 (En- FINET Features coder Profil 4.1) coder-Profil 4.2) Fiber Optic Cable Fiber Optic Kabeldiagnose bie- Nicht implementiert Nicht implementiert diagnostics tet verbesserte Diagnose für die Wartung für den Fall, dass das Kabel im Laufe der Zeit an Si- gnalstärke verliert Fast Startup...
4 Installation Kübler Group 4 Installation 4.1 Elektrische Installation 4.1.1 Allgemeine Hinweise für den Anschluss ACHTUNG Zerstörung des Gerätes Trennen Sie vor dem Stecken oder Lösen der Signalleitung immer die Versorgungsspannung und sichern Sie diese gegen Wiederein- schalten ab. HINWEIS Allgemeine Sicherheitshinweise Beachten Sie, dass die gesamte Anlage während der Elektroinstalla- tion in spannungsfreiem Zustand ist.
Kübler Group 4 Installation Schnitt- Kabel (nicht verwendete Adern sind vor Steckverbinder stelle schluss- Inbetriebnahme einzeln zu isolieren) Stecker LINK 1 Signal TxD+ RxD0 TxD- RxD- LINK 2 Signal TxD+ RxD0 TxD- RxD- Spannungsversorgung Signal – – Die beiden äußeren Drehgeber-Anschlüsse „PORT 1“ und „PORT 2“ dienen zur Profinet-Kom- munikation (der Drehgeber ist dabei ein Profinet-Device).
4 Installation Kübler Group sind die Daten-Ports gleichwertig und können beliebig ausgewählt werden. Nach Festlegung ei- ner bestimmten Topologie in der HW-Konfiguration (z. B. für LLDP, IRT, MRP) dürfen sie aber nicht mehr vertauscht werden. 4.1.4 Netzwerktopologie Netzwerktopologien ergeben sich aus den funktionalen Anforderungen, die an das jeweilige Netzwerk gestellt werden.
Seite 19
Kübler Group 4 Installation • Bei der Stern-Topologie besteht jede Verbindung zwischen dem zentralen Netzteilnehmer und einem anderen Netzteilnehmer aus zwei Leitungen – eine zum Senden, eine zum Emp- fangen. Das gesendete Signal eines Netzteilnehmers wird über den zentralen Netzteilnehmer an alle anderen gesendet.
5 Inbetriebnahme und Bedienung Kübler Group 5 Inbetriebnahme und Bedienung 5.1 Funktions- und Status-LED Am Drehgeber befinden sich vier Diagnose–LEDs. Anzeige LED Bedeutung LINK 1 LINK 1 ist eine LED des PROFINET Ports, die beim vorhandenen Link an ist, beim Datenaustausch (Activity) blinkt, anderenfalls aus ist. LINK 2 LINK 2 ist eine LED des PROFINET Ports, die beim vorhandenen Link an ist, beim Datenaustausch (Activity) blinkt, anderenfalls aus ist.
Kübler Group 5 Inbetriebnahme und Bedienung ERROR-LED Anzeige Bedeutung Fehlerursache Zusatz Keine Profinet- -> Verkabelung prü- Positionsfehler, Grenz- Verbindung fen. wertüberschreitung der aufgebaut Temperatur, Inbetriebnah- -> PN-Controller(SPS) me-Fehler, Watchdog einschalten. oder Prozessdatenschnitt- -> Gerätenamen wie in stelle zwischen Microcon- „Hardwarekonfigurati- troller und Slave on“...
Seite 22
5 Inbetriebnahme und Bedienung Kübler Group HINWEIS Installation der Gerätebeschreibungsdatei Die zugehörige .bmp-Datei muss sich während der Installation im gleichen Ordner wie die .xml-Datei befinden. ü Stellen Sie sicher, dass dem Rechner, der zur Projektierung genutzt wird, eine statische IP-Adresse zugewiesen wurde. ü...
Kübler Group 5 Inbetriebnahme und Bedienung 5.2.1.2 Konfigurierung des Drehgebers ü Markieren Sie den hinzugefügten Drehgeber. a) Klicken Sie auf die Registerkarte „Gerätesicht“. Stellen Sie dort den Gerätenamen sinnvoll ein. 108555403 b) Ziehen“ Sie je nach gewünschtem „Ein-/Ausgabe-Datenformat“ (siehe zugehöriges Kapitel) eines der Module aus dem Hardware-Katalog in die „Geräteübersicht“...
5 Inbetriebnahme und Bedienung Kübler Group 108559243 e) Passen Sie ggfs. die E/A-Adressen für den zyklischen Datenaustausch wunschgemäß an. 108561163 f) Optional können Sie Einstellungen unter Steckplatz „0“ („X1= Interface“, „X1 P1 = Port 1“ und „X1 P2 = Port 2“) vornehmen. g) Wählen Sie „Priorisierter Hochlauf“...
Seite 25
Kübler Group 5 Inbetriebnahme und Bedienung HINWEIS IP-Adresse identifizieren Die IP-Adresse des Gerätes können Sie über „Projektnavigation/Onli- ne-Zugänge/Netzwerkkarte/Erreichbare Teilnehmer aktualisieren“ in Erfahrung bringen. ü Stellen Sie sicher, dass alle notwendigen Konfigurationsparameter korrekt eingestellt wur- den. ü Achten Sie darauf, dass die in der Gerätekonfiguration eingestellte IP-Adresse der CPU mit der tatsächlichen IP-Adresse übereinstimmt.
Seite 26
5 Inbetriebnahme und Bedienung Kübler Group 108568843 c) Markieren Sie in der nun erscheinenden Liste die Zeile mit Gerätetyp „KUEBLER“ und dem noch fehlenden Gerätenamen. Klicken Sie auf „LED BLINKEN“ und kontrollieren Sie ob die grüne PWR-LED am Drehgeber blinkt. d) Klicken Sie schließlich auf „Name zuweisen“.
Kübler Group 5 Inbetriebnahme und Bedienung 108538123 5.2.3 Rücksetzen auf Werkseinstellung Es besteht die Möglichkeit die Profinet-Schnittstelle des Drehgebers wieder auf „Werkseinstel- lungen“ zu setzen. Damit werden u. a. der Gerätename und die IP-Adresse gelöscht. HINWEIS Preset Position Das „Rücksetzen auf Werkseinstellung“ bezieht sich nur auf die PN- Schnittstelle.
Seite 28
5 Inbetriebnahme und Bedienung Kübler Group HINWEIS Gerätenamen Falls der PN-Controller (SPS) läuft und eine der aktuellen Topologie entsprechende LLDP-Konfiguration enthält, wird dem gerade „auf Werkseinstellungen“ gesetzten Gerätes nach ein paar Sekunden au- tomatisch der konfigurierte Name zugewiesen (und ggfs. die PN-Ver- bindung aufgebaut).
Kübler Group 5 Inbetriebnahme und Bedienung 108540043 5.3 Beschreibung der Konfigurationsparameter 5.3.1 Generelle Parameter HINWEIS TMR und MUR Bei einem Multiturn Drehgeber muss der TMR Wert auf MUR x Anzahl der gewünschten Umdrehungen gesetzt werden, z. B. 8192 x 4096 = 33554432. Maximal MUR x 4096.
Seite 30
5 Inbetriebnahme und Bedienung Kübler Group HINWEIS Positionswert G1_XIST1 Ist G1_XIST1 deaktiviert und der Positionswert steigt über den Maxi- malwert oder fällt unter 0, gibt das Gerät den maximalen Positions- wert innerhalb des skalierten Gesamtbereichs für den Positionswert G1_XIST2 aus. Der Positionswert G1-XIST1 ist nicht auf den skalierten Gesamtbe- reich begrenzt.
Kübler Group 5 Inbetriebnahme und Bedienung • Relativer Preset: 0…+/-(„TMR“-1) Beim Aufbau der Profinet-Verbindung wird der hier angegebene Preset-Wert automatisch vom Profinet-Controller (SPS) eingestellt. Bei Bedarf kann der Preset-Wert auch später noch verän- dert werden (siehe Kapitel „Azyklische Datenübertragung“). Bei Auslösung des Preset-Vorgangs über das „ManTel860“ (Manufacturer Telegram 860) wird der Preset-Wert dagegen direkt über die zyklischen Ausgangsdaten gesetzt.
5 Inbetriebnahme und Bedienung Kübler Group Ausgabe-Daten PRESET UINT 32 Byte Bit 31 Bit 30 …Bit 0 Preset Presetvalue < Total Measuring Range (TMR) Control Bedeutung Bit 31 = Trigger-Bit: Durch Übergang von 0 auf 1 wird ein Preset-Vorgang ausgelöst (dauert bis zu 40 ms).
Seite 33
Kübler Group 5 Inbetriebnahme und Bedienung ZSW2_ENC G1_ZSW G1_XIST1 G1_XIST2 Byte Byte Byte Byte Byte Byte Byte Byte Byte Byte Byte Byte Byte Rei- LSB MSB hen- folge Bit 15…12: „Enco- Bit 15: „Sensor Er- Aktuelle Drehgeber- Aktuelle Drehgeber- deu- der Sign-Of-Life“...
Seite 34
5 Inbetriebnahme und Bedienung Kübler Group ZSW2_ENC G1_ZSW G1_XIST1 G1_XIST2 existieren keine rücksetzbaren Feh- ler) Beispiele F2 00 20 00 00 00 12 34 00 00 12 34 => Position (gültig) = 1234h = 4660dez F2 00 30 00 00 00 12 34 00 00 12 34 =>...
Seite 35
Kübler Group 5 Inbetriebnahme und Bedienung Ausgabe-Daten STW2_ENC G1_STW Byte Byte 0 Byte 1 Byte 2 Byte 3 Reihenfolge MSB Bedeutung Bit 15…12: Bit 15: „Controller Sign-Of-Life“ = 1…15 „Acknowledge Sensor Error“ = 0 Wird derzeit ignoriert, sollte aber (für Derzeit existieren keine rücksetzbaren zukünftige Kompatibilität) ständig verän- Fehler.
5 Inbetriebnahme und Bedienung Kübler Group HINWEIS Preset Wert Anders als beim ManTel860 wird der Preset Wert beim StdTel81 zy- klisch übertragen. Für den Wert selber bedeutet dies, dass dieser nicht im Submodul selbst übertragen wird, sondern auf eine Variable zurückgreift.
5 Inbetriebnahme und Bedienung Kübler Group Ausgabe-Daten Zustandswort Byte Byte 0 Byte 1 Reihenfolge Bedeutung Das Zustandswort bestimmt Drehgeberzustände, Bestätigun- gen und Fehlermeldungen wichtiger Drehgeberfunktionen. Bit 15…12: „Encoder Sign-Of-Life“ = 1…15, 1…15, „Lebenszeichen“ des Drehgebers. Ändert sich mit jedem PN-Sendetakt (1 ms). Bit 9: „Control Requested“...
Kübler Group 6 Instandhaltung 6 Instandhaltung In rauen Umgebungen empfehlen wir eine regelmäßige Inspektion auf festen Sitz und auf mög- liche Beschädigungen des Gerätes. Reparaturen dürfen nur vom Hersteller durchgeführt werden, siehe Kapitel Kontakt [} 47]. Vor den Arbeiten • Schalten Sie die Energieversorgung ab und sichern Sie diese gegen Wiedereinschalten. •...
7 Anhang Kübler Group 7 Anhang 7.1 Azyklische Datenübertragung - PNIO Record Read/Write Für die azyklische Kommunikation können bei einer Siemens-SPS (S7) die „Standard-Blöcke“ SFB52=RDREC („Read Record“) und SFB53= WRREC („Write Record“) verwendet werden. 7.2 Telegramm - Base Mode Parameter Access 0xB02E-Telegramm: Preset-Wert setzen Dieses Telegramm wird beim Aufbau der Profinet-Verbindung automatisch gesendet („Preset“- Parameter der Hardware-Konfiguration;...
Kübler Group 7 Anhang 7.3 Telegramm - Write User Parameter Data 0xBF00-Telegramm Dieses Telegramm wird beim Aufbau der Profinet-Verbindung automatisch gesendet (abhängig von den einstellbaren Drehgeber-Parametern „UserParamData“ der Hardware-Konfiguration). Bei Bedarf können die Einstellungen jedoch auch noch bei laufender Profinet-Verbindung geän- dert werden.
7 Anhang Kübler Group 7.4 Telegramm - Read Operating Status/Parameter 0xBF00-Telegramm Hiermit können neben den aktuellen Einstellungen auch evtl. vorliegende Fehler und Warnun- gen abgefragt werden. API: 0x3D00, Slot/Subslot: 0x1/0x1, Index:0xBF00 (48896dez) Antwortdaten: 48 Bytes = 12 Langworte (MSBfirst): Index Bedeutung Details (Byte)
Seite 43
Kübler Group 7 Anhang 83423371 Um einem Positionsfehler entgegenzuwirken, werden bei der USF die Schritte pro Umdrehung durch einen dezimalen Bruch ersetzt. Dieser Bruch beschreibt das Übersetzungsverhältnis der Applikation. Beispiel mit Übersetzungsverhältnis Ein Werkzeugwechsler mit 12 Werkzeugen soll gesteuert werden. Dabei kann TMR durch die Anzahl der Werkzeugaufnahmen berechnet werden.
Seite 44
7 Anhang Kübler Group 160299915 Soll der Drehgeber nun von jeder Station aus wieder von 0 zu zählen beginnen, kann auch dies mit der USF realisiert werden. Die Gesamtauflösung TMR beträgt 1500. Dieser Gesamtmessbe- reich soll pro Umdrehung des Tisches 7-mal durchlaufen werden. Damit resultiert der Dezimal- bruch = 1/7.
Kübler Group 8 Kontakt 8 Kontakt Sie wollen mit uns in Kontakt treten: Technische Beratung Für eine technische Beratung, Analyse oder Unterstützung bei der Installation ist Kübler mit sei- nem weltweit agierenden Applikationsteam direkt vor Ort. Support International (englischsprachig) +49 7720 3903 952 support@kuebler.com Kübler Deutschland +49 7720 3903 849...
Glossar Kübler Group Glossar Einheit: Baud. 1 Baud ist die Ge- Number of Distinguishable Revolutions schwindigkeit, wenn 1 Symbol pro Se- kunde übertragen wird. Nicht zu ver- wechseln mit Bitrate. Modulationsver- Open Systems Interconnection. fahren mit mehr als zwei Zuständen Schichtenmodell zur Beschreibung der haben eine höhere Bit- als Baudrate Funktionsbereiche in einem Daten-...
Seite 49
Kübler Group Fritz Kübler GmbH Schubertstr. 47 D-78054 Villingen-Schwenningen Germany Phone +49 7720 3903-0 Fax +49 7720 21564 info@kuebler.com www.kuebler.com...